Ironically, only two species of palm are native to the entire State of Texas. The Texas Sabal, which grows naturally in South Texas on the coastal prairie & the Dwarf Palmetto which grows naturally in the Piney Woods of East Texas & along the Gulf Coast.
Some palm states, such as California that have far more palm trees than Texas only has one native species. The California Fan.
Florida is just a palm lovers paradise with about 11 different species of native palm trees.
